    How to qualify renovation enquiries before they waste your time

    June 2025 · 4 min read

    Every renovation business has the same complaint: most enquiries are price-checkers, browsers or wrong-fit projects. The fix isn't more leads - it's better filtering before any human time is spent.

    The three things to confirm

    • Scope - what they actually want built (kitchen, extension, bathroom, full renovation)
    • Timeline - when they want it started (this month, this quarter, exploring)
    • Budget range - whether it sits inside what you build for

    Where qualification should happen

    It should happen automatically, in conversation, within minutes of the enquiry arriving. WhatsApp and on-site chat both work well - the goal is a short back-and-forth that feels human but runs without your team.

    Once the three filters are confirmed, the enquiry is routed to a human for a real conversation. Anything that doesn't pass is logged but not pushed to sales.

    Why this matters more than lead volume

    Doubling lead volume without qualification just doubles the time wasted. Halving lead volume but qualifying properly usually books more jobs - because the team is only spending time on enquiries that can convert.

    Won't automated qualification put serious buyers off?

    Done well, the opposite. A fast, professional qualification flow signals operational quality - which is exactly what premium homeowners are looking for.

    What about enquiries that don't pass qualification?

    They stay in the pipeline on a long-cycle nurture. Some will be ready in 60 or 90 days. The point is they don't consume sales time today.
